PERSONAL

Mr. E. C. Cutten. S.M., left for the (South by last evening’s Limited. Mr. Dynes Fulton arrived from Wellington this morning on the Limited. Mr. R. Semple, M.P., arrived in Auckland yesterday morning o® a short visit. Mr. B. B. Wood, of Christchurch, was u passenger from the South this morning on the Limited. Mr. P. Hally, Conciliation Commissioner, left for the South by the express last evening. Captain J. W. Monro, of the Canterbury Steam Ship Co., arrived in Auckland this morning from the South. Mr. J. G. Rickerby, traffic manager lor railways in the Auckland district, left by train last evening for Wellington. Mr. Justice Blair and Mrs. Blair returned from Wellington on Saturday. They are staying at the Hotel Cargen. Dr. Donald McKenzie, son of the Rev* j. G. McKenzie, of Epsom, has qualiled as a Fellow of the Pwoyal College - f Surgeons, London. Mr. Bert Royle, of the Wellington lirad office of J. C. Williamson. Ltd., is seriously ill. Mr. John Farrell, man.isjer of the Auckland office, will leave tomorrow evening for Wellington. Mr. C. J.
